Where Do Baby Elephants Nurse . Baby elephants are adorably uncoordinated and often trip, fall in holes, and need help from the herd. The calves drink their mother's milk for about two years, sometimes longer. Then they start testing solid foods, and gradually shift their nutrient intake over the next two years. But they may continue nursing occasionally until they are displaced by mom’s next offspring. Like humans, elephants are mammals, and they nurse their young with milk produced by the mother’s mammary glands.
